The March 22, 2024 Data Breach

On March 22, 2024, KTU&A Planning & Landscape Architecture experienced a significant data security incident that resulted in the unauthorized access to personal information of numerous individuals. The breach was promptly identified, and measures were taken to secure the systems and mitigate any potential harm. This incident has raised concerns about the security measures previously in place and has prompted a thorough investigation.

Information Exposed

The following types of consumer information were exposed during the data breach:

  • Names
  • Social Security Numbers
  • Dates of birth
  • Addresses
  • Driver's license numbers
  • Credit information

KTU&A Planning & Landscape Architecture's Response

In response to the breach, KTU&A has taken several steps to address the situation and assist those affected. The company has partnered with IDX, a data breach and recovery services expert, to offer complimentary credit monitoring and identity theft protection services to all impacted individuals. These services include 24 months of credit and CyberScan monitoring, a $1,000,000 insurance reimbursement policy, and fully managed identity theft recovery services.

Steps to Take if You Are Affected

If you believe your information was compromised in this breach, there are several actions you can take to protect yourself:

  1. Enroll in the complimentary credit monitoring and identity theft protection services offered by IDX.
  2. Place a security freeze on your credit reports by contacting each of the three major consumer reporting agencies: Equifax, Experian, and TransUnion. This will prevent credit, loans, and services from being approved in your name without your consent.
  3. Obtain a copy of your credit report from Annual Credit Report to check for any unauthorized activity or transactions.
  4. Stay vigilant and monitor your financial statements and accounts for any signs of unauthorized transactions. If you detect any, report them immediately to your financial institution.
  5. Consider placing a fraud alert on your credit reports to warn creditors that you may be a victim of identity theft.
